History Chypre Perfume from Wikipedia.

The word chypre is French for Cyprus. It was most famously used in perfumery by François Coty, who created an influential perfume of that name in 1917.

However, perfumes of a similar style had been created throughout the 19th century.Before the 20th century, perfumery was generally an art of recreating nature. According to perfume expert Luca Turin, the two fragrances that began to abstract that idea were Coty's Chypre and Chanel No. 5 (created in 1921).
